方法

GtkTextItereditable

声明 [src]

gboolean
gtk_text_iter_editable (
  const GtkTextIter* iter,
  gboolean default_setting
)

描述 [src]

返回iter处的字符是否在文本的可编辑区域内。

不可编辑的文本是“锁定”的,用户不能通过GtkTextView来更改。如果对此文本应用了不影响可编辑性的标签,将返回default_setting

您不应使用此函数来确定是否可以在iter处插入文本,因为在插入的情况下,您不需要知道iter处的字符是否在可编辑范围内,而是需要知道新车段是否会被插入到可编辑范围内。请使用gtk_text_iter_can_insert()来处理这种情况。

参数

default_setting

类型: gboolean

TRUE 如果文本默认可编辑。

返回值

类型: gboolean

判断iter是否在可编辑范围内。